Why Choose Non-VoIP Numbers for Your Company
In today's rapidly evolving business landscape, organizations are constantly seeking innovative ways to optimize their communication infrastructure. While VoIP has gained significant traction, non-VoIP numbers continue to offer a variety of advantages that make them an attractive alternative for businesses of all sizes.
- Firstly, non-VoIP lines are renowned for their exceptional reliability. They operate on traditional PSTN networks, which have a proven track record of stability and resilience. This makes them an ideal choice for businesses that require uninterrupted access
- Secondly, non-VoIP numbers often provide enhanced call quality. As they are not reliant on internet bandwidth, calls tend to be clearer and more consistent, particularly in areas with unreliable internet service. This is crucial for businesses that depend heavily on phone discussions
- Lastly, non-VoIP numbers can offer greater security. Traditional phone lines are less susceptible to cyberattacks, providing an added layer of protection for sensitive information. This is particularly important for businesses handling confidential customer data or engaging in high-stakes discussions

Grasping Non-VoIP Numbers and Their Applications
In the dynamic landscape of modern communication, several alternatives to traditional Vo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P) systems have emerged. Non-VoIP numbers provide a alternative approach to phone service, leveraging existing telecommunication infrastructure. These numbers are frequently associated with landlines or mobile platforms, functioning independently of internet connectivity. Understanding the characteristics and purposes of non-VoIP numbers is essential for businesses and individuals seeking flexible and reliable communication solutions.
Non-VoIP numbers offer several advantages. Their stability stems from their integration with established telephone networks, ensuring uninterrupted service even during internet outages. Moreover, they often provide greater call sound compared to some VoIP services, particularly in areas with inconsistent internet connections.
- Additionally, non-VoIP numbers may be simply integrated with existing business telephone systems, simplifying communication workflows.
- For individuals, they offer a sense of security due to their tangibility in the traditional telephony realm.
